1. ENGINE, COOLING SYSTEM AND FUEL SYSTEM
1.1 GENERAL
XE engine
V-belt tension
(1) Raw-edge V-belts can be recognised by the absence of
textile fabric in the rubber, with the exception of the top of
the belt edge, on the edges and the insides of the belt
(polished belt edges). Version: either a toothed or a non-
toothed belt.
(2) After fitting the new V-belt, set the pre-tension to the
"setting tension" and after a trial run check whether the
pre-tension complies with the "test tension". If the test
tension reading is lower than the value specified in the
table, set the V-belt to the minimum "test tension".
(3) If the V-belt tension is lower than the "minimum tension",
set the belt to the "adjusting tension".
Valve clearance
Valve clearance (cold/hot)
Inlet 0.50 mm
Exhaust 0.50 mm
DEB
DEB setting 1.40 mm
V-belt tension, "AVX" raw edge (1)(N)
Application example: air-conditioning compressor drive
New V-belt (2)
Setting tension 600
Test tension 400
Run-in V-belt (3)
Minimum tension 250
Adjusting tension 350
V-belt tension, "XPB" raw edge (1)(N)
Application example: steering pump drive on FAX vehicle
New V-belt (2)
Setting tension 1250
Test tension 950
Run-in V-belt (3)
Minimum tension 750
Adjusting tension 950

1.2 TIGHTENING TORQUES
The tightening torques specified in this paragraph
are different from the standard tightening torques
cited in the overview of the standard tightening
torques. The other threaded connections not
specified must therefore be tightened to the
torque cited in the overview of standard
tightening torques.
When attachment bolts and nuts are replaced, it
is important - unless stated otherwise - that these
bolts and nuts are of exactly the same length and
property class as those removed.

Lubrication system
Total capacity (including oil cooler and oil filter) approx. 34 litres
Capacity of oil sump, maximum level approx. 30 litres
Capacity of oil sump, minimum level approx. 22 litres
Cooling system
Cooling system approx. 47 litres
With integrated retarder approx. 57 litres
